URGENT UPDATE: A tragic motorbike accident in Sheffield has claimed the life of 14-year-old Dalton Beavis. The horrific incident occurred on Monday, July 14, 2023, when Dalton was struck by a black Ford Mondeo while riding his white Stomp Juice 110 motorbike at approximately 6:15 PM.

Immediate efforts were made to save Dalton’s life. A nearby police officer on patrol was flagged down and quickly reached the scene, providing first aid until paramedics arrived. An off-duty nurse also assisted, but despite their best efforts, Dalton was pronounced dead after being rushed to the hospital.

Tributes have flooded social media as friends and family mourn the loss of a vibrant young life. One heartfelt message from his family expressed gratitude for the outpouring of support, stating, “Upon request of Dalton Beavis’ beloved family, they would like to say a thank you to all the love, support and keeping his memory alive.”

Friends shared memories online, with one posting, “He always said something that made me laugh,” while another wrote, “Fly high Dalton Beavis, rest in peace.” Community members have laid flowers and balloons at the scene on Tunwell Avenue, alongside cans of Red Bull, symbolizing Dalton’s youthful spirit.

A memorial balloon release is planned for 5 PM on July 18, 2023, at Concord Park. Everyone is invited to attend, but organizers remind participants to be considerate of Dalton’s childhood friends during this difficult time.

The driver of the Ford Mondeo, a 30-year-old man, remained at the scene and was subsequently arrested on suspicion of causing death by careless driving. He has since been released on bail as the investigation continues.

Authorities are actively seeking witnesses to come forward with any information related to the incident. This tragic event serves as a stark reminder of the risks faced by young riders and the profound impact of road safety.
